Summary:

The research group of Shekhar Bhansali at Vanderbilt University is seeking a highly motivated Postdoctoral Researcher to lead the development of next-generation implantable biosensors integrated within minimally invasive needle platforms. This role presents an exciting opportunity to contribute to pioneering technologies for real-time health monitoring and precision medicine.

Job Description:

The Postdoctoral Researcher will focus on:

  • Designing and fabricating microscale and nanoscale biosensor components using cleanroom-based microfabrication techniques (e.g., photolithography, thin-film deposition, etching).
  • Developing and optimizing electrochemical sensing strategies including amperometric, potentiometric, and impedance-based detection methods.
  • Functionalizing sensor surfaces with biological recognition elements (e.g., enzymes, antibodies, aptamers) for selective analyte detection.
  • Integrating sensing elements into needle-based platforms suitable for minimally invasive or implantable applications.
  • Performing electrochemical and analytical characterization in biological environments.
  • Analyzing experimental data and refining device performance through iterative design.
  • Collaborating with interdisciplinary researchers across engineering, materials science, and biomedical domains.
  • Preparing manuscripts, reports, and presentations to disseminate research findings.

Eligibility/Qualifications:

  • Strong expertise in microfabrication techniques, including photolithography, thin-film deposition, and etching.
  • Solid background in electrochemistry with hands-on experience in techniques such as amperometry, potentiometry, or impedance spectroscopy.
  • Experience in biosensor development and surface functionalization for chemical or biological sensing.
  • Proficiency in experimental design, data analysis, and problem-solving.
  • Excellent written and verbal communication skills.
  • Demonstrated publication record in peer-reviewed journals.
  • Ability to work independently and collaboratively in a multidisciplinary environment.

Preferred Qualifications:

  • Experience with implantable or wearable medical devices.
  • Familiarity with microfluidics and lab-on-chip systems.
  • Knowledge of biocompatible materials and packaging strategies.
  • Experience translating laboratory prototypes into functional devices.
